2.2
配置静态路由
<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/>

1、 
网络中的每个数据链路确定子网或网络地址

2、 
每台路由器标识所有非直连的数据链路

3、 
每台路由器写出关于每个非直连地址的路由语句

 

Ip route
目标地址
子网掩码
下一跳

 

可以这样理解人(
IP
去白下区瑞金路
25
 
下一站是珠江路——————做公交车

要把表给填满,你写的其实的公交车的行程表。那你在每个站都要贴上一张公交的表。而且是一样的公交表。看
公交站的那张表
~~
每个站的公交站台的那张表

 

午间的阳光略微带点刺眼,却舒适的让我想一直一直被这阳光温暖着,叶子像是上了最上好的护肤品,在阳光的照射下亮亮的
~
娇嫩的迎春花星星点点的开着。淡×××的小花就这样入了眼,暖了心。

 

实验

TOP

配置静态路由的表项

(具体的配置见附件)

实验我是用
dynamips
做的。
net
文件也放在附件里面

Pooh(config)#ip route 192.168.1.192 255.255.255.224 192.168.1.66

Pooh(config)#ip route 10.1.0.0 255.255.0.0 192.168.1.66

Pooh(config)#ip route 10.4.6.0 255.255.255.0 192.168.1.66

Pooh(config)#ip route 10.4.7.0 255.255.255.0 192.168.1.66

 

Tigger(config)#ip route 192.168.1.0 255.255.255.224 192.168.1.65

Tigger(config)#ip route 10.1.0.0 255.255.0.0 192.168.1.194

Tigger(config)#ip route 10.4.7.0 255.255.255.0 10.4.6.2

 

Piglet(config-if)#ip route 192.168.1.64 255.255.255.224 192.168.1.193

Piglet(config)#ip route 192.168.1.0 255.255.255.224 192.168.1.193

Piglet(config)#ip route 10.4.6.0 255.255.255.0 192.168.1.193

Piglet(config)#ip route 10.4.7.0 255.255.255.0 192.168.1.193

 

Eeyore(config-if)#ip route  192.168.1.0 255.255.255.224 10.4.6.1

Eeyore(config)#ip route 192.168.1.64 255.255.255.224 10.4.6.1

Eeyore(config)#ip route 192.168.1.192 255.255.255.224 10.4.6.1

Eeyore(config)#ip route 10.1.0.0 255.255.0.0 10.4.6.1

 

查看路由表

注意在配置静态路由的时候,必须要满足的条件。首先
IP
路由选择必须启动,如果使用下一跳地址,那么该地址必须可达,出站接口必须配置
ip
地址,接口必须正常工作。

(个人心得,这个
cisco
3
层交换机在做静态路由的时候麻烦先敲
ip routing~~
我老是会忘导致静态敲完发现不通
~
其实是路由选择没有开启
~~
汤小莹要长记性呀
~

 

静态路由还有一种表示方法:用出站接口代替下一跳路由器的接口地址,其中通过出站接口可以到达目标网络

如果静态路由参照出站接口,那么他们将被作为直连网络输入到路由表中。

先把你原来配的静态删掉
Tigger

配置如下

Tigger(config)#no ip route 10.1.0.0 255.255.0.0 192.168.1.194

Tigger(config)#no ip route 10.4.7.0 255.255.255.0 10.4.6.2

Tigger(config)#no ip route 192.168.1.0 255.255.255.224 192.168.1.65

Tigger(config)#

Tigger(config)#ip route 10.1.0.0 255.255.0.0 f0/0

Tigger(config)#ip route 10.4.7.0 255.255.255.0 s1/1

Tigger(config)#ip route 192.168.1.0 255.255.255.224 s1/0

查看路由表

 
这边可以看到
Piglet
代理
arp,
这边不管这些
ip
地址是不是有效都会触发一个
arp

 

如果直接把静态路由指向一个广播型出站接口,而不使用下一跳地址,可能会导致广播网络上出现过多的流量,而且还可能耗尽路由器的内存。

 

静态路由还有第三种写法:

联合出站接口和下一跳

如果在静态路由表后面加上下一跳地址,那么路由器就不在人为目标网络是直连网络了。这个时候
ARP
请求对象只可能是下一跳地址,只有第一个去往
10.1.0.0
的数据包才会触发
ARP
请求。

Tigger(config)#ip route 10.1.0.0 255.255.0.0 FastEthernet0/0 192.168.1.94

Tigger(config)#ip route 10.4.7.0 255.255.255.0 Serial1/1 10.4.6.2

Tigger(config)#ip route 192.168.1.0 255.255.255.224 Serial1/0 192.168.1.65

 

Tigger(config)#do sh arp

Protocol  Address          Age (min)  Hardware Addr   Type   Interface

Internet  192.168.1.193           -   ca01.10c0.0000  ARPA   FastEthernet0/0

Internet  192.168.1.194           1   ca02.10c0.0000  ARPA   FastEthernet0/0

仔细看
arp
~

网络不再被直接连接了,而是有了下一跳。出口是
F0/0

 

联想:这个就像是你在做地铁的时候要去某个地方,你会先看你图的下一站来,来判断你是站在左边还是右边。如果有人告诉你左边还是右边,你就可以直接排队了(
arp
代理找不到东西比喻了)。其实最精确的告诉的方法是告诉你站左边还是右边还告诉你下一站是什么。你会很安心的。